System Blueprint Diagrams : Recommended Guidelines & Tools

Creating clear system design diagrams is vital for collaboration among stakeholders. Implement these best methodologies : Emphasize readability – leverage common notations and avoid unnecessary detail. Consider different diagram types such as component diagrams, infrastructure diagrams, and event diagrams, choosing the most one for your audience . Numerous tools are accessible to assist in developing these visual representations; explore options like Visio, a diagramming replacement , or free platforms to find what suits your needs .

Interpreting Application Architectures: Architecture Chart Requirements

Navigating complex technology systems can feel overwhelming. Creating a clear design diagram is paramount to visualizing the overall layout. These schematic depictions aren't just pretty pictures; they’re essential for collaboration across departments . A well-crafted diagram should distinctly depict key components , their relationships , and the flow between them. Key elements to include are:

  • Server categories and their purposes.
  • Data environments and their placement .
  • Network paths and safeguards.
  • Integration junctions with outside services .

Ultimately, these models serve as a critical tool for architects, support teams, and anyone engaged in managing the system landscape .
